Visceral Yet Story Driven
9 September 2023
Woman of the Hour is a film that men should see accompanied by a woman. The reactions and truth of them from women during this movie might be the only way someone like me (a white male) can even begin to glimpse the gravitas of what it is like to be targeted because you are deemed defeatable in a physical struggle. Anna Kendrick as Cheryl Bradshaw is not the story of this film. Anna Kendrick as the director who inherently knows how to portray this deplorable action to the viewer in the perfect weight while maintaining a level of humor, sharpness and pace to her debut directing project gives many characters depth while never seeming to overdramatize any particular situation. One can only hope more brilliant scripts are hitting her front door with vigor asking for her behind the camera as well as in front.
